Mitsubishi Electric just paid $1.4 billion for a control point
On August 20, Mitsubishi Electric agreed to acquire 100% of PCI Energy Solutions, the Oklahoma-based energy-management software business, for a base value of $1.4 billion. The final price will be adjusted at closing for the usual cash, debt and working-capital items. Subject to regulatory approvals and standard conditions, the companies expect to close the deal during 2026.
This is not Mitsubishi buying a trendy AI wrapper, slapping a Japanese logo on it and calling it innovation. PCI sits in the ugly, valuable middle of the power industry: forecasting demand, scheduling generation, managing trading, handling risk, settlement, transmission and distribution workflows, and optimising energy assets.
In plain English: it helps the people who keep the lights on decide what power to make, buy, move and sell — and when.
Mitsubishi says PCI’s platform is used across roughly 60% of U.S. power generation. That is the number that matters. Not because every unit of that generation is captive revenue, obviously, but because it tells you PCI has achieved what most founders spend their lives chasing and never get near: embedded relevance in a critical workflow.
PCI is not a giant by headcount. It has about 350 employees, with its main base in Norman, Oklahoma, and offices in Mexico City and Lima. That means Mitsubishi is paying roughly $4 million per employee if you want the lazy back-of-the-envelope number.
But that would miss the point completely.
Mitsubishi is not buying 350 people. It is buying decades of industry knowledge, hard-won customer trust, integration depth, specialised software and a place in workflows where failure is expensive. It is buying a platform that utilities and energy companies cannot casually rip out on a Tuesday afternoon because some procurement bloke found a cheaper vendor.
That is what strategic value looks like.
Why the power market has become software’s best hunting ground
The old electricity world was comparatively straightforward. Big generators made power. Networks moved it. Consumers used it. Planning was complicated, sure, but the system was built around predictable supply and relatively predictable demand.
That world is gone.
Renewables have made supply more variable. Distributed generation has added more moving parts. Batteries, electrified transport, data centres and industrial demand are changing the shape of consumption. Power markets must coordinate physical equipment, volatile prices, weather forecasts, contractual commitments and regulatory obligations at the same time.
The more complex the system gets, the more valuable the decision layer becomes.
That is PCI’s lane. It does not need to own a turbine, a transmission line or a battery to matter enormously. It sits between the assets and the economic decisions made around them.
Mitsubishi already sells the physical side of the energy world: equipment, controls, public-utility systems, factory automation and infrastructure technology. Its stated strategy has been to push harder into smart energy, combining energy management, monitoring and control with digital and AI capabilities.
PCI gives it a far more credible software brain for that ambition.
And Mitsubishi is not hiding the commercial objective. It has said it wants to combine PCI’s optimisation capabilities with its own control technologies, components, energy-management offering and digital platform. The deal is about expanding the solution, not merely adding another product catalogue item.
That distinction matters.
A manufacturer selling equipment gets paid when something is built or replaced. A software-led operator that becomes part of a customer’s daily planning, market participation and optimisation gets a much tighter relationship — and potentially a far more durable one.

The overlooked risk: big companies can suffocate the thing they paid for
Now for the bit nobody at the deal announcement wants to dwell on.
Mitsubishi Electric is a massive industrial group, with more than 200 group companies, about 150,000 employees worldwide and fiscal 2026 revenue of ¥5.8947 trillion. PCI is a 350-person specialist business that has won by being close to customers in a niche market.
Those are very different organisms.
The obvious risk is that Mitsubishi buys a nimble, customer-obsessed software business and then buries it under procurement layers, reporting lines, approval committees and a corporate sales process built for equipment cycles.
That would be a very expensive own goal.
To its credit, Mitsubishi has said it intends to retain PCI’s core management team, while PCI has said day-to-day operations, customer support, active projects and existing service commitments will continue unchanged before closing. That is sensible. The people who understand the industry and the product are not a post-deal inconvenience. They are the asset.
But intention is not execution.
Every buyer says it will preserve culture. Then someone in head office decides the new subsidiary needs the same expense policy, sales approvals and product governance as a division selling industrial hardware. Before long, the entrepreneurial edge has been sanded off and the customers begin getting phone calls from competitors.
The contrarian view is this: Mitsubishi should not rush to “integrate” PCI in the way corporate advisers love to describe it. It should integrate capabilities and incentives, yes. It should protect the operating speed that made PCI worth buying in the first place.
If you acquire a specialist because it knows something you do not, do not immediately teach it to behave like you.
This deal is really a warning to hardware businesses
The uncomfortable truth for industrial companies is that hardware increasingly risks becoming the visible but lower-margin part of the customer relationship.
The machine, battery, inverter, sensor or control system still matters. But the software layer that decides how assets are used, maintained, traded and optimised can capture an outsized share of the value.
That is where the recurring revenue sits. That is where usage data accumulates. That is where the customer’s operational habits become embedded. And that is where switching gets painful.
Mitsubishi has clearly understood this. It is not abandoning hardware. It is making a play to own more of the decision-making around hardware.
Smart operators should notice the pattern.
In any industry getting more complex, ask: who owns the workflow after the product is sold? Who sees the data? Who helps the customer make money, avoid loss or reduce risk every day? Who would create a proper operational mess if they disappeared?
That company is often more valuable than the one making the physical thing.
The same principle applies well beyond energy. Logistics, insurance, healthcare, construction, agriculture, manufacturing and finance are all full of businesses selling products into systems that are becoming too complicated to run without software.
Do not just look for the supplier. Look for the control point.
